National instruments labview fpga driver

May 20, 2019 look under my system software labview version and verify that fpga is in the dropdown menu for your version of labview. Nivisa provides support for customers using ethernet, gpib, serial, usb, and other types of instruments. Labview fpga programming follows the same basic steps of those of the labview graphical system design package itself. See below for previous version support information. Install programming environments such as ni labview or microsoft visual studio before installing this product. Labview 2010 graphical software adds offtheshelf compiler technologies to execute code faster, improves development productivity and delivers new features suggested. Test engineers now have even more options for programming their softwaredesigned instruments such as ni vector signal transceivers vsts with the release of instrument driver fpga extensions. In a compactrio system, a controller with a processor and userprogrammable fpga is populated with one or more conditioned io modules from ni or. Use graphical structures and io nodes to build custom digital circuits. The netscope device is delivered with the labview instrument driver interface.

National instruments enhances labview fpga community. Find prewritten curriculum with labview and national instruments fpga board as well as examples, technical documentation, and answers to frequently asked. Labview manuals directory that contains these documents by selecting start. The software combines intuitive graphical programming with tools for managing complex system. Labview fpga module release notes national instruments. Choosing the right fpga hardware national instruments.

Labview fpga is a software addon for labview that you can use to more efficiently and effectively design fpga based systems through a highly integrated development environment, ip libraries, a highfidelity simulator, and debugging features. National instruments corporation 5 fpga module release notes module 7. Optional national instruments device drivers cd labview fpga module 1. National instruments increases ip availability with new ni. Since the application was written in labview and the test station used nican hardware, the drivers were entirely written. The lab includes background information regarding state machines and inlab exercises.

This solution might also apply to other similar products or applications. Ni digital electronics fpga board software download national. Labview fpga 20 includes new ip libraries that allow you to easily implement fpga based highperformance algorithms. Labview 2014 fpga module readme national instruments.

An introduction to instrument driver fpga extensions for. Refer to the labview realtime module release notes for information about installing the labview realtime module and the device drivers you need. In labview fpga, you can configure the exact type of trigger condition you need, based on the value of analog input channels. Extending the labview platform through partnerships with the release of labview 2010, national instruments is introducing the labview addon developer program to give thousands of partners the opportunity to expand the platform and introduce custom functionality into labview. You can use this driver to communicate with sent transmitters as a sent receiver when you connect sent transmitters to hardware with fpga digital io lines. The papilio board seems to be focusing on education of fpga programming, as one can use the xilinx ise webpack, which is made available for free by xilinx, to actually program and synthesize vhdl program to the board. Sent driver api national instruments ni labview fpga driver for sent protocol. Electric vehicle energy management system using national.

Our network of companies are uniquely equipped and skilled to help solve some of the toughest engineering projects. Using the ni 951x drive interface modules in labview fpga. National instruments recommends a 64bit os for the computer on which you install the xilinx compilation tools. The labview fpga course prepares you to design, debug, and implement efficient, optimized applications using the labview fpga module and reconfigurable io rio hardware. Labview fpga is a software addon for labview that you can use to more efficiently and effectively design fpgabased systems through a highly integrated development environment, ip libraries, a highfidelity simulator, and debugging features. Field programmable gate array fpga is an integrated circuit with configurable logics. The labview 2014 fpga module does not support windows 8 or windows 8. Instrument driver fpga extensions allow you to customize a softwaredesigned instrument fpga in labview while preserving the full feature set of the instrument driver apis see figure 1.

This package was created and is officially supported by national instruments. Aug 28, 2019 other support options ask the ni community. Look under my system software labview version and verify that fpga is in the dropdown menu for your version of labview. National instruments enhances labview fpga community forums. Kevin townsend, computation designer answered jan 16, 2015 i dont have much experience with labview platform. Watch these short videos to see what its like to program in labview fpga, and implement basic tasks using analog. Niatca provides support for using the fpga module for atca. It started life as a software package for the control and management of test equipment, but. Some functions in the nifpga package may be unavailable with earlier versions of your rio driver. You learn how to compile and deploy your vis to different types of ni targets, such as ni r series multifunction rio, compactrio, singleboard rio, and ni rio instruments. Labview fpga module the labview fpga module helps you develop and debug custom hardware logic that you can compile and deploy to ni fpga hardware. Dec 27, 2014 this board seems to be the precursor or one of them of what i am hoping to be another wave of the makers movement.

A 64bit version of the labview fpga module was released in 2018. With the labview fpga module and labview, you can create vis that run on ni fpga targets, such as reconfigurable io rio devices. Device driver softwareto program most devices with the labview 2014 fpga module, install the nirio 14. In this lab, students will learn about the state machine system architecture, and apply it to automate a robot arm to follow a set of rules while navigating a map. Labview fpga module it is only necessary to inst all the labview fpga module if you want to reconfigure the default personality of the ni cvs1459rt io. As many of you probably know, i was involved in the creation of a labview compiler for arduino, one that allows labview code to be deployed to and to run embedded in any arduino compatible. Install the ni flexrio devices this section describes how to unpack and install the ni flexrio fpga module and the ni flexrio adapter module. These devices span many different form factors, from rugged to highperformance systems, all based on this same architecture. Our network of companies are uniquely equipped and skilled to. Also achieve tighter timing for control loops or operations with a validated deterministic os. Labview fpga is a software addon for labview that you can use to more efficiently and effectively design fpgabased systems through a highly integrated development environment, ip libraries, a highfidelity simulator. National instruments compactrio and labview syaifuddin mohd. National instruments adds c programming to labview fpga.

It started life as a software package for the control and management of test equipment, but since then its scope has been expanded and it is described as a graphical system design environment and it can be used in a variety of other roles. Dmc developed a set of j1939 protocol drivers for labview which are based on the nican channel api provided by national instruments ni. Refer to the labview fpga module release and upgrade notes for installation instructions and information about getting started with the. Note national instruments is committed to maintaining compatibility with microsoft windows technology changes. May 15, 20 learn how you can use labview system design software to program an fpga hardware target. This driver works with ni singleboard rio hardware and ni 940x c series modules. Instrument driver fpga extensions bridge between the unparalleled flexibility of an open fpga and the compatibility of standard instrument drivers. The toolkit helps you execute models on a host computer for desktop simulation, labview realtime simulation, and fpga based simulation. The sent driver api provides the ni labview fpga code for the single edge nibble transmission sent protocol communication engine. Labview 2018 fpga module help national instruments. Those logics can be programmed using hardware description language such as vhdl and verlog to implement specific functions. However, ni has become aware of a number of issues of potential significance regarding microsoft windows 7. Digital electronics fpga board hardware driver for.

National instruments ni flexrio installation manual pdf download. Dmc needed to interface to a customers automotive ecu over can using the sae j1939 protocol as part of an automated test application. Beginning with the release of compactrio device drivers 17. The labview fpga module enables you to develop fpga vis on a host computer and compile and implement the code on ni reconfigurable io rio hardware. Use a previous version of compactrio device drivers to continue using these modules in labview fpga mode. Collaborate with other users in our discussion forums.

In labview, students will tune the system, configure states, and validate system behavior. Implemented data simulation mode in labview fpga to vaildate data path for 802. Home shop products tagged national instruments, labview addons. Labview fpga lets you graphically implement digital circuits within an fpga chip. Enhanced online resource and community offers new ip for any labview fpga application. A 3d printer running marlin firmware can be used as a generic xyz motion controller for your experimental needs through the use of a labview instrument driver. National instruments corporation ni pxi7854r virtex5 lx110 r series multifunction rio module 8 ai, 8 ao, 96 dio 750kssec for labview fpga 8 analog inputs, independent sampling rates up to 750 khz, 16bit resolution, 10 v. You can install the latest version of each of these software components separately from. The ni labview fpga module helps you develop and debug custom hardware logic that you can compile and deploy to ni fpga hardware. Learn how you can use labview system design software to program an fpga hardware target. The labview fpga module is only compatible with 32bit versions of labview full and labview professional as of labview fpga module 2017. Electric vehicle energy management system using national instruments compactrio and labview. Software support not installed in labview fpga national.

You can create fpga vis that combine direct access to io with userdefined labview logic to define. Christopher boyd senior software engineer national. Labview nxg web module the labview nxg web module enables the creation of webbased user interfaces with draganddrop widgets, communication mechanisms, and secure hosting. Welcome to the fpga interface python apis documentation. New pioneer software from national instruments opens. Labview instrument driver for 3d printer with marlin. Installing labview, labview realtime and fpga modules, and ni. Continuously monitor an analog input channel and make use of only samples that are above a certain userdefined threshold. Implement an or trigger to specify multiple trigger conditions within fpga hardware. Labview electric motor simulation toolkit download. Error 61499, internal software error in labview fpga. National instruments has implemented this powerful microprocessor plus fpga architecture in its fpgaenables devices.

In 2009, national instruments began naming releases after the year in which they are released. Since you are currently enrolled at or employed by the university of nebraskalincoln, you may use the ni software resources for your academic studies and noncommercial research purposes. National instruments today introduced its new version of ni labview fpga ipnet, an online resource that helps digital design engineers browse, download and share the latest intellectual property ip for fieldprogrammable gate array fpga design applications. Labview instrument driver for 3d printer with marlin firmware. Industriecontroller bieten hohe verarbeitungsleistung sowie anschlusse fur.

New pioneer software from national instruments opens labview. Ni has just published a white paper titled labview fpga 20 productivity enhancements an. The nifpga package contains an api for interacting with national instruments labview fpga devices from python. This file contains important information about the labview instrument driver import wizard 2. To be determined detailed product specification, manufacturer data sheets, prices and availability. National instruments ni does a wonderful job of abstracting hardware description language hdl from the g developer so one can write g code very similar to regular labview and have a working fpga application in minutes. The labview fpga module helps you develop and debug custom hardware logic that you can compile and deploy to ni fpga hardware. Labview for arduino first labview for any fpga next. Click to expand the embedded development and deployment folder.

National instruments, labview addons, labview yotta volt. This applies to labview fpga too as it is just an extension of the base g language labview graphical programming language. In 2009, national instruments began naming releases after the. The ni national instruments guibased labview development environment has an fpga module that allows you to extract realtime performance from several of the companys fpga and zynqbased hardware products. Jul 02, 2018 choosing the right fpga hardware national instruments.

National instruments announces labview 2010, the latest version of the graphical programming environment for design, test, measurement and control applications. Review the licensed product list, which includes the labview environment, modules, and toolkits you have valid licenses for in addition to device drivers. Instrument driver network idnet find, download, or submit a driver to communicate with thirdparty instruments. Labview is a proprietary software package developed and sold by national instruments. Ni atca is an ni instrument driver that helps you create labview fpga applications. An instrument driver is a set of sub vis that allows someone to quickly and easily build a vi using the instrument.

The program establishes an online marketplace as part of the updated. National instruments silicon valley area sales manager join our. Those functions of fpga can be changed on the fly by downloading the new function bitstream to the device. Sent driver api national instruments ni labview fpga driver. It features a labview project template for electric simulation, control, and hardwareintheloop hil, as well as veristand software addons for the various motor types. For other supported versions of the help, launch from product or download from this page. Select and configure ni reconfigurable io rio hardware create, compile, download, and execute a labview fpga vi and use ni rio hardware perform measurements using analog and digital input and output channels create host computer programs that interact with fpga vis control timing, synchronize operations and implement signal processing on the fpga design and. It seems that he has let his instructor know that ive worked with xilinx fpgas for over 10 years and now everyone is counting on me to get these boards working. Sent driver api national instruments ni labview fpga. My son has just made me aware that his high school owns a dozen national instruments digital electronics fpga boards but they have never been able to get them to work or actually use them in curriculum.

The software combines intuitive graphical programming with tools for managing complex system configurations, multirate dsp design of the. Search the alliance partner directory to find the right alliance partner to help meet your needs. Labview communications system design suite, designed by national instruments, supports select usrp motherboard and daughterboard configurations with the goal of accelerating productivity by providing a seamless tool flow from the desktop pc to fpga. Handson with labview, jenkins, python and perforce experience in azdo work items. Getting started with labview fpga national instruments. The netscope device gets process data from the automation network and provides the process data to labview. Select and configure ni reconfigurable io rio hardware create, compile, download, and execute a labview fpga vi and use ni rio hardware perform measurements using analog and digital input and output channels create host computer programs that interact with fpga vis control timing, synchronize operations and implement signal processing on the.

789 962 411 1071 662 300 439 57 302 587 1357 528 1025 281 1203 299 225 305 1448 296 79 6 831 1219 1210 1353 884 260 1400 134 1213 1323 1282 909 701 1305